About Karin Hollerbach

My current interests are in the intersection of aviation and aerial vehicles as sensor platforms; data integration from multiple sensor types, including real-time; situational awareness; remote and extreme environments; verticals especially in scientific research, infrastructure, sustainability, emergency services or defense. I love flying airplanes, adventure, volunteering in emergency services, practicing aikido (meditation), and spending as much time as possible outdoors.
